A Journey Through Australian History: From Ancient Times to Modern Nationhood

Australia’s history is incredibly rich and extends back more than 65,000 years, making it home to one of the world’s oldest continuous living cultures – that of its Indigenous peoples. This ancient past is filled with complex societies, intricate kinship systems, and a profound connection to the land.

When European settlement began with the arrival of the First Fleet in 1788, a new and often challenging chapter in Australian history commenced. Questions in an Australia quiz might cover the significance of Captain Cook’s explorations, the impact of penal colonies, or the gold rushes of the 19th century that dramatically transformed the nation. The Federation of Australia in 1901, which saw the six colonies unite to form a single nation, is another pivotal moment often featured in quizzes.

Subsequent periods, including Australia’s involvement in World Wars, its post-war immigration boom, and its evolving relationship with Indigenous Australians, all offer fertile ground for historical inquiry. Understanding these historical layers helps to contextualize modern Australia and its enduring challenges and triumphs.
